| Deja-vue 2003-08-05, 11:41 pm |
| The Game costs between $32.00 and $44.99, depends on where you are buying it. ( i'd go with amazon.com).
Then, you could choose "The Road to Rome" add-on pack, another $16.00 to $19.99.
The recent Release "Desert Combat" is really awesome, download for free right here
Careful, it is about 350 megs to download.
The Game has hefty requirements, my Neighbors Athlon 800, 512 megs of Ram and Geforce 440 is bearly running it.
Better with a XP 2000+ and a good Videocard.
There is thousands of Players online playing this awesome Game every day.
Get the Game, all the Patches ( 1.4 right now), download Desert Combat and then....Challenge me!
